The Volunteer’s Role

Cuso International in Peru seeks an individual to support our partner organization, Instituto de Defensa Legal (IDL), in promoting and raising awareness of their Constitutional Litigation Area (ALC) activities and legal cases both nationally and internationally.

As a volunteer, you will work closely with the team to share updates on activities such as court judgments, legal hearings, reports, articles, briefs, and statements, depending on their significance.

You will collaborate with IDL's communications department to publicize activities through media outlets and engage with both local and foreign press in Peru. Responsibilities may include drafting press releases, capturing photographs and videos, writing articles, and sharing content via social media and other platforms.

You will also translate press releases, articles, and communications materials into English for international dissemination, distributing them among activist networks, NGOs, and IDL allies.

Additionally, you may broadcast press conferences and events via IDL's social media channels and participate in all ALC meetings, coordinating with team members in Lima and other provinces.

This position is based in Lima, working with a multidisciplinary team focused on monitoring public policies related to human rights, justice, security, environment, and indigenous peoples.

About Us, the Project, and the Partner

Cuso International is an organization working to create economic and social opportunities for marginalized groups, focusing on gender equality and social inclusion, economic resilience, and climate action. Founded in 1961, operating in Africa, Latin America, the Caribbean, and Canada.

We value individuals committed to supporting marginalized groups, including LGBTQIA+ communities.

Project - Sharing Canadian Expertise for Inclusive Development and Gender Equality (SHARE)

Funded by Global Affairs Canada (GAC), this seven-year project (2020-2027) aims to improve the well-being of marginalized populations, especially women and girls, contributing to the Sustainable Development Goals and promoting inclusive, sustainable development initiatives.

Partner - Instituto de Defensa Legal

Founded in 1983, IDL is a Peruvian NGO dedicated to human rights advocacy, legal defense, judicial reform, governance, citizen security, and indigenous and women's rights.
